

Sonoco Announces Paperboard, Tubes and Cores Price Increases
HARTSVILLE, S.C.--([ BUSINESS WIRE ])--Sonoco (NYSE: SON) will increase prices for all uncoated recycled paperboard grades in the United States and Canada by $30 per ton effective with shipments on Nov. 29, 2010. In addition, the Company announced that it will increase prices on all paperboard tubes and cores in the United States and Canada by 5 percent effective with shipments on Nov. 29, 2010.

aPrices for old corrugated containers in the Southeast have increased by one-third in the past three months, which is unprecedented during what is normally the highest material generation time of the year,a said Harris DeLoach, Sonoco chairman, president and chief executive officer. aStrong domestic and export demand is causing an imbalance in the supply of recovered paper, which is our primary raw material. It is essential that we begin recovering these higher input costs.a
The Nov. 29 price increase for the Companya™s uncoated recycled paperboard grades is in addition to a $35 per ton increase which went into effect on Oct. 11, 2010.
